DNA repair by Ogt alkyltransferase influences EMS mutational specificity.
Carcinogenesis - 1 Apr 1995
Vidal A, Abril N, Pueyo C
Abstract excerpt
Forward mutations induced by ethylmethane sulfonate (EMS) in the lacI gene of Escherichia coli were recovered from bacteria proficient or deficient in the alkyltransferase encoded by the constitutive ogt gene. EMS doses of 100 or 200 mM (Ogt+) and of 50 mM (Ogt-) were selected from the corresponding dose-response curves for DNA sequence analysis.
